WebMay 17, 2024 · The K‐State Focus on Feedlots is a monthly publication that summarizes feedlot performance and closeout data from cooperating commercial cattle feeding operations in Kansas. Each year I summarize the data from the monthly reports, in an effort to document annual trends in fed cattle performance and cost of gain. WebJan 7, 2024 · Feeding cost of gain averaged approximately $100 per cwt. in 2024 ranging from a low of $82.28 in January to $109.54 in October. Relatively high corn prices will likely keep feeding cost of gain during the next six months above $100 per cwt. Feeding cost of gain for the first quarter of 2024 is expected to range from $104 to 107 per cwt.
